Output 86bb61e9935b1a70182d74cfc6cd35449a5399f8af121402268aa014ad8b30f9:0

value
183745735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d97d9867e05e12430eca4c6b97c5891becd95b4 OP_EQUALVERIFY OP_CHECKSIG
address
12EshCQ3JQzJQeKgyHq8TZfdCEts7PUtKc
transaction
86bb61e9935b1a70182d74cfc6cd35449a5399f8af121402268aa014ad8b30f9
confirmations
444203
spent
true